컴퓨터시스템과
컴퓨터시스템 엔지니어링 분야의 실무형 전문가 양성을 목표로
현장중심의 교육과정을 운영하고 임베디드시스템 소프트웨어
개발 직무 중심의 미래형전문기술인 인재 양성을 목표로 합니다.
교과목 | 교육내용 |
---|---|
프로그래밍 기초 | 소프트웨어 개발 입문자를 위한 언어(예: Python)를 사용하여 프로그래밍의 기본 개념을 소개하고 범용 프로그래밍은 물론 머신러닝에서 활용도가 높은 라이브러리들을 학습하는 기회를 제공한다. |
AI/ML 개론 | 인공지능과 머신러닝의 기본 개념을 소개하고 다양한 유형의 머신러닝 문제들에 대한 No Code, Low Code 혹은 Code 기반 해결책을 실습 중심으로 학습한다. |
오픈 플랫폼 (기초, 응용) | 가장 대표적인 오픈 플랫폼인 라즈베리파이에 관하여 학습한다. 기본 환경설정에서 부터 주변기기 제어 까지 라즈베리에 관한 기초에서 심화내용 까지 다루며, 이후 취업 관련 산업체에서 사용하는 플랫폼에 대한 학습이 추가 될 수 있다. |
임베디드애플리케이션 (기초, 응용) | 임베디드리눅스 운영체제 중심의 플렛폼에 대해서 대표적인 사례 중심으로 응용 소프트웨어 개발에 필요한 기초 이론 및 실습을 통해 임베디드 응용 소프트웨어 개발 기술을 학습한다. |
리눅스 (기초, 응용) | 리눅스 일반, 리눅스 운영 및 관리, 리눅스 활용 등의 내용으로 리눅스마스터 2급 자격증 관련 내용 학습 |
아두이노코딩 | 아두이노는 기초 컴퓨터 시스템으로 초보자 컴퓨터시스템 코딩 입문에 적합하며 비전공자도 쉽게 접근이 가능하여 4차산업혁명 시대에 꼭 학습해야 하는 교과목이다. |